The Green Party of Ontario will:


1. Make an unambiguous statement regarding the value to society of family members who choose to care for children by paying them for raising children for their first three years. In a phased manner, begin the transfer of money earmarked for daycare for under 3's directly to individual mothers.

2. The Green Party will utilize early childhood specialists to help parents with their parenting where desired or needed.

3. Recognizing the solid evidence that breastfeeding is one of the most effective prevention measures available we will provide public education about the benefits of breastfeeding.

4. Until families are embedded in meaningful communities the Green Party will mitigate the isolation experienced by parents raising small children by ensuring that the network of locally administered and community - run Parent/Child Family Resource Centres is available to all.

5. The Green Party will work to build meaningful communities - neighbourhoods with community cohesion, trust, and a sense of belonging which, among other benefits, will eliminate the isolation currently affecting parents of young children.

6. Acknowledging the singular importance of a positive birthing experience to parent and child The Green Party will facilitate easy access to doulas, midwives and birthing centres.

7. The Green Party will implement extensive and intensive parenting education for every boy and girl before he or she reaches an age when conception is a possibility.

8. Create incentives to increase the number of part - time and work - at - home jobs.


9. Educate parents and children about making healthier living choices through improved prenatal classes, increased physical education in schools, and greater collaboration between daycares and local parks and recreation programs.


Approved May 27th 2006
